public abstract class AbstractWritePoiParser
extends java.lang.Object
| Modifier | Constructor and Description |
|---|---|
protected |
AbstractWritePoiParser(org.apache.poi.ss.usermodel.Workbook workbook) |
| Modifier and Type | Method and Description |
|---|---|
protected java.lang.String[] |
getSplittedPropertyName(java.lang.String propertyName) |
protected org.apache.poi.ss.usermodel.Workbook |
getWorkbook() |
boolean |
isCreateHeaderRow() |
protected java.lang.Object |
readCellValueFromObjectField(java.lang.Object object,
java.lang.String fieldName) |
protected java.lang.Object |
readCellValueFromObjectProperty(java.lang.Object object,
java.lang.String propertyName) |
void |
setColumnHeaderProperties(ColumnHeaderProperties columnHeaderProperties) |
void |
setCreateHeaderRow(boolean createHeaderRow) |
protected void |
writeDataCell(org.apache.poi.ss.usermodel.Row row,
java.lang.Object cellValue,
CellDescriptor cellDescriptor) |
protected void |
writeDataRow(org.apache.poi.ss.usermodel.Sheet sheet,
int index,
java.lang.Object value,
java.util.Set<CellDescriptor> sheetCellDescriptors) |
protected void |
writeDataRows(org.apache.poi.ss.usermodel.Sheet sheet,
TypedList<?> values,
java.util.Set<CellDescriptor> sheetCellDescriptors) |
protected void |
writeHeaderCell(java.lang.String sheetName,
org.apache.poi.ss.usermodel.Row headerRow,
CellDescriptor sheetCellDescriptor) |
protected void |
writeHeaderRow(org.apache.poi.ss.usermodel.Sheet sheet,
java.util.Set<CellDescriptor> sheetCellDescriptors) |
protected void |
writeSheet(java.lang.String sheetName,
TypedList<?> values,
java.util.Set<CellDescriptor> sheetCellDescriptors) |
protected AbstractWritePoiParser(org.apache.poi.ss.usermodel.Workbook workbook)
protected void writeSheet(java.lang.String sheetName,
TypedList<?> values,
java.util.Set<CellDescriptor> sheetCellDescriptors)
protected void writeHeaderRow(org.apache.poi.ss.usermodel.Sheet sheet,
java.util.Set<CellDescriptor> sheetCellDescriptors)
protected void writeHeaderCell(java.lang.String sheetName,
org.apache.poi.ss.usermodel.Row headerRow,
CellDescriptor sheetCellDescriptor)
protected void writeDataRows(org.apache.poi.ss.usermodel.Sheet sheet,
TypedList<?> values,
java.util.Set<CellDescriptor> sheetCellDescriptors)
protected void writeDataRow(org.apache.poi.ss.usermodel.Sheet sheet,
int index,
java.lang.Object value,
java.util.Set<CellDescriptor> sheetCellDescriptors)
protected void writeDataCell(org.apache.poi.ss.usermodel.Row row,
java.lang.Object cellValue,
CellDescriptor cellDescriptor)
protected java.lang.Object readCellValueFromObjectProperty(java.lang.Object object,
java.lang.String propertyName)
protected java.lang.Object readCellValueFromObjectField(java.lang.Object object,
java.lang.String fieldName)
public boolean isCreateHeaderRow()
public void setCreateHeaderRow(boolean createHeaderRow)
protected org.apache.poi.ss.usermodel.Workbook getWorkbook()
protected java.lang.String[] getSplittedPropertyName(java.lang.String propertyName)
public void setColumnHeaderProperties(ColumnHeaderProperties columnHeaderProperties)
Copyright © 2011-2020 BSTOI.NL. All Rights Reserved.